The Scandic KNA is a prime example of the Latin term "caveat emptor" or "buyer beware". While there are numerous posts that claim that this hotel is wonderful (which could have been the case), our experience differed dramatically. We found the lobby a little dingy, but figured what mattered was the room. Unfortunately the room was a disaster. We had booked a family room for my wife, daughter and I, and found the following:
- filthy bed comforters
- pull-out couch with a layer of dust
- windows that wouldn't open
- spartan, under-lit bathroom that had not been cleaned since the last guest had left (the layer of hair on the floor gave it away)
Needless to say, we did not stay, but the hotel was good about letting us check out without a fuss. The woman at the front desk asked if I wanted to speak with the manager, so at least they seemed receptive to our situation.
The bottom line is that while many have had a good experience at this hotel, others (such as me) have not...so "caveat emptor"!
